Lent Sermon Series
Continues This Week
The journey of Lent is underway. We're on a 46-day (well, 37 days now) journey through the season of preparation for Holy Week & Easter. We're going to spend the Lent season at Buckhall journeying with Jesus through what's called the Journey Narrative. This is the story of Jesus' final journey to Jerusalem that we find in Luke 9-19. I hope that this series feeds your soul and brings us all closer to Jesus in this Lenten season.
